In this episode, Nicole shares a deeply personal and Spirit-led reflection on the election of Pope Leo XIV — the first American-born pope, a missionary, an Augustinian, and, perhaps most importantly, a quiet firestarter.
This isn’t just commentary on Church news. This is a holy reckoning — the kind that stirs hearts and reminds us why the Church is alive, roaring, and still moved by the breath of the Spirit.
Nicole breaks down the symbolism of Pope Leo’s first public moment, what his surprising background reveals, and why his presence is already echoing the legacy of St. John Paul II.
But more than that, she invites listeners to consider their own role in this unfolding story. Because the papacy isn’t just about one man — it’s about the Body of Christ rising to meet the moment.
